ABOUT THE DEPARTMENT
The Athletic Office Worker serves as a support staff member for the Athletics Department by assisting with daily operations, customer service, administrative tasks, and departmental events. This position provides student employees with hands-on experience in collegiate athletics operations, event management, campus engagement, and student support services.
POSITION SUMMARY, ROUTINE TASKS & RESPONSIBILITIES
General Office Support Assist with daily office operations and administrative tasks Answer phones, greet visitors, and provide customer service to guests, students, and staff File documents, organize records, and maintain office materials Assist with data entry, copying, scanning, and other clerical duties Help prepare materials for meetings, recruiting visits, and athletic events Campus Tours and Visitor Engagement Assist with guided campus tours for prospective student-athletes and families Help coordinate recruiting visit schedules and hospitality needs Provide a positive and professional representation of the institution and athletics department Additional Responsibilities Complete other duties as assigned by athletics administration or supervising staff Maintain professionalism and confidentiality within the athletics department Adhere to all institutional, departmental, and NCAA policies and procedures Ability to stand for extended periods during events or tours Ability to lift and move light to moderate equipment and supplies Ability to work in office, athletic facility, and outdoor event environments Minimum Qualifications High School Diploma or GED Registered full-time SSU student Eligible to work in the United States Strong communication and interpersonal skills Demonstrate reliability, punctuality, and follow instructions Ability to work independently and as part of a team Basic proficiency with Microsoft Office and social media platforms Follow SSU dress code policy
